π« Amex Kills Activating Offers on Multiple Cards
Historically many tools like CardPointers have been able to use a workaround to activate Amex offers on multiple cards at once. Unfortunately, that βstopped workingβ for most people this past week, so each offer can only be activated on one card (which is the way Amex always intended).

π U.S. Bank Finally Has Transfer Partners
After a year of delays, U.S. Bank βlaunched its first four transfer partnersβ for Altitude Reserve cardholders, but two of them (Flying Blue and Qantas) are no longer showing up. That leaves Ethiopian at 1:1 and Accor at 2:1. The Accor transfer will only get you ~1.15¢/point, but Ethiopian is interesting, with βbusiness class from 15,000 milesβ.

π¨ Recommendation: Hyatt Family Plan
When traveling with our family I much prefer booking a suite that has room for all of us, but sometimes it's not possible or wildly expensive, so we need to book two rooms. In that case, you should know that Hyatt has an βunpublished Family Plan Rateβ that takes up to 50% off a second room when you're traveling with kids. I actually booked two second rooms with points that I'm about to cancel because 50% of the cash rate is a much better deal. To book these rates, you can call the hotel, message β@HyattConciergeβ on X or email your My Hyatt Concierge (if you're Globalist). Note that the second room has to be a cash rate, but the first room can be cash or points.
